Women, children, and the elderly being evacuated from South Ossetia

Evacuations are under way in South Ossetia for women, children, and the elderly in the conflict zones. They are being taken to North Ossetia, according to the press committee of the Republic of South Ossetia. According to IA Regnum’s source, due to the worsening situation, the evacuation of civilians has begun in the settlement of Dmenis (in the Tskhinvali region of South Ossetia), as well as the evacuation of children in Tskhinvali. An emergency session of the government of the republic is planned for today.

“In order to avoid the loss of civilian life, the administration of the settlement made the decision to evacuate children, women, and the elderly to Northern Ossetia, as tensions have escalated,” reported South Ossetian authorities.

As has already been reported, the shootings on Ossetian settlements, including on the capital of the Republic of South Ossetia, Tskhinvali, from the evening of August 1 through August 2, have left 6 people dead and 13 wounded. According to Vladimir Ivanov, assistant commander of the Joint peacekeeping forces (SSPM) in the conflict zone, 4 of the dead were killed by sniper fire.
